Do Filipinos need visa to visit UK?

The citizens of the Philippines, as many other nationalities, cannot travel to the United Kingdom unless they obtain a visa in advance. If your trip is for business, tourism, or medical purposes, you have to acquire a UK Standard Visitor Visa. It is not possible to apply for and receive one online.

Do you need a visa to work in UK from Philippines?

Filipinos holding a Philippine passport who take the big step on moving to the UK will need a visa, whether it’s for tourism, study or work purposes. Some long-term work visas include the following: General work visa (Tier 2)

How long can a Philippine tourist stay in the UK?

The visa can be valid for 2, 5 or 10 years and you can stay in the UK for a maximum of 6 months every time you visit. It is important to know that for travelers under 18 years old, the long-term visit visa will only be valid for up to 6 months after you turn 18.

How much does it cost to get a UK student visa from the Philippines?

The Tier 4 student visa fees from the Philippines are ₱22,100 ($442). In fact, the UK visa fee Philippines 2019 for a Tier 4 student application with priority service is ₱36,400 ($728) i.e. application charges ₱22,100 ($442) plus the priority service cost of ₱14,300 ($286).

How long does a British passport need to be valid in the Philippines?

Passport validity. As of November 2015, the Philippine Bureau of Immigration has amended its rules about passport validity. British passports no longer need to have a minimum period of 6 months validity from the date of arrival. Your passport should be valid for the proposed duration of your stay.
